AI policy researcher reverses course: most lawyers will be replaced by AI within years

LuizaJarovsky · x · 2026-09-17

AI policy researcher Luiza Jarovsky publicly reverses her earlier stance, arguing most lawyers will likely be replaced by AI in the coming years unless governments protect human work. She points to rapidly shrinking entry-level jobs, warns mid-level roles and AI-dependent startups are next, and says a global recession within a few years may be unavoidable — with real recovery 5-10 years away.
